1. منتجات
  2.   جدول
  3.   GO
  4.   Gotenberg Go Client
 
  

مكتبة Free Go لتحويل ملفات جداول بيانات Microsoft ®

قم بتحويل مستندات جداول بيانات Microsoft Excel XLSX و XLS إلى PDF عبر Open Source Go API  

باستخدام مكتبة عملاء Gotenberg Go مفتوحة المصدر ، يمكن للمطورين تحويل مستندات Excel بسهولة إلى PDF في تطبيقاتهم الخاصة. باستخدام API ، يمكنك تحويل تنسيق ملفات XLS و XLSX و ODS إلى PDF بسهولة. تسمح API بتحويل ملف واحد أو أكثر في نفس الوقت ، ويتم دمج جميع الملفات في ملف PDF واحد. علاوة على ذلك ، تقوم واجهة برمجة التطبيقات بدمج المستندات أبجديًا.

بشكل افتراضي ، سيتم تقديم مستند PDF الناتج باتجاه عمودي لكن واجهة برمجة التطبيقات تسمح بتخصيص الاتجاه. بشكل افتراضي ، يتم تثبيت عدد قليل من الخطوط. يتم أيضًا دعم الأحرف الآسيوية خارج الصندوق. علاوة على ذلك ، يمكنك تعيين أرقام الصفحات ووقت انتهاء عملية التحويل.

Previous Next

الشروع في العمل مع عميل Gotenberg Go

الطريقة الموصى بها لتثبيت عميل Gotenberg Go في مشروعك هي باستخدام GitHub. الرجاء استخدام الأمر التالي للتثبيت السلس.

قم بتثبيت عميل Gotenberg Go عبر GitHub

$ go get -u github.com/thecodingmachine/gotenberg-go-client/v7 

قم بتحويل XLSX إلى PDF عبر Free Go API

يتيح عميل Gotenberg Go للمكتبة مفتوحة المصدر لمبرمجي الكمبيوتر تحويل XLSX إلى PDF داخل تطبيقات Go الخاصة بهم. لتحويل XLSX إلى PDF ، تحتاج فقط إلى تحميل المستند وتحويله باستخدام طريقة gotenberg.NewOfficeRequest (). باستخدام سطور التعليمات البرمجية التالية ، يمكنك بسهولة تحويل XLSX إلى PDF.

تحويل Excel إلى PDF في GO

  1. قم بتحميل ملفي XLSX باستخدام طريقة NewDocumentFromPath () وتمرير اسم الملف ومسار الملف كمعلمات
  2. قم بتحويل كلا الملفين إلى PDF باستخدام طريقة gotenberg.NewOfficeRequest () وتمرير كائنات doc
  3. احفظ مستند PDF

قم بتحويل XLSX إلى PDF عبر Free GO API

c := &gotenberg.Client{Hostname: "http://localhost:3000"}
doc, _ := gotenberg.NewDocumentFromPath("document.xlsx", "/path/to/file")
doc2, _ := gotenberg.NewDocumentFromPath("document2.xlsx", "/path/to/file")
req := gotenberg.NewOfficeRequest(doc, doc2)
dest := "result.pdf"
c.Store(req, dest)
 عربي